Prem Watsa
is an enormously successful investor in the model of
Warren Buffett
, who invests the float of his insurance conglomerate, Fairfax
Financial. In the second quarter, he opened six new positions:
Resolute Forest Products (
RFP
), IntegraMed America (
INMD
), GigOptix (
GIG
), Provident New York Bancorp (
PBNY
), Taiwan Fund Inc. (
TWN
) and JAKKS Pacific (
JAKK
).
Resolute Forest Products (
RFP
)
Watsa bought 18,460,790 shares of Resolute Forest Products in the
second quarter of 2012. The new position comprises 11.2% of his
portfolio.
Resolute Forest Products Inc. manufactures a diverse range of
forest products including newsprint, commercial printing papers,
market pulp and wood products. It has a P/E ratio of 9.98 and P/S
ratio of 0.26.
IntegraMed America (
INMD
)
Watsa's second-largest purchase comprises 0.024% of his
portfolio. He bought 33,000 shares of IntegraMed America at an
average price of $13 in the second quarter.
IntegraMed America Inc. is a physician practice management
company which provides comprehensive management support services
to a network of medical providers of women's health care
services. Integramed America has a market cap of $166.9 million;
its shares were traded at around $13.97 with a P/E ratio of 26.8
and P/S ratio of 0.6. Integramed America had an annual average
earnings growth of 11.6% over the past 10 years. GuruFocus rated
Integramed America
the business predictability rank of 3.5-star
.
GigOptix (
GIG
)
GigOptix bought 84,748 shares of GigOptix in the second quarter.
GigOptix, a fabless semiconductor manufacturer, provides
electronic engines for the optically connected digital world.
Provident New York Bancorp (
PBNY
)
Watsa bought 25,000 shares of Provident New York Bancorp at an
average price of $8 in the second quarter of 2012.
Provident New York Bancorp is a full-service independent
community bank that helps families and businesses make the most
of life's opportunities. Provident New York Bancorp has a market
cap of $312.7 million; its shares were traded at around $8.29
with a P/E ratio of 16.5 and P/S ratio of 2.2. The dividend yield
of Provident New York Bancorp stocks is 2.9%. Provident New York
Bancorp had an annual average earnings growth of 9.3% over the
past 10 years.
Taiwan Fund Inc. (
TWN
)
Watsa bought 11,438 shares of Taiwan Fund at an average price of
$16 in the second quarter of 2012.
Taiwan Fund Inc. is a closed-end, diversified management
investment company with an investment objective of long-term
capital appreciation through investment primarily in equity
securities listed on the Taiwan Stock Exchange. Taiwan Fund Inc.
has a market cap of $287.9 million; its shares were traded at
around $15.57.
JAKKS Pacific (
JAKK
)
Watsa bought 10,301 shares at an average price of $18 in the
second quarter of 2012.
JAKKS Pacific is a multi-line, multi-brand toy company that
designs, develops, produces and markets toys and related
products. JAKKS Pacific has a market cap of $417.3 million; its
shares were traded at around $16.4 with and P/S ratio of 0.6. The
dividend yield of JAKKS Pacific stocks is 2.5%.
Watsa also sold several stocks:
Watsa sold out of his position in
Primero Mining Corp. (
PPP
)
in the second quarter. Primero Mining Corp. is engaged in
exploration, acquisition and development of mineral resource
properties. Primero Mining Corp. New Common Shares (Canada) has a
market cap of $342.5 million; its shares were traded at around
$3.98 with a P/E ratio of 8.3 and P/S ratio of 2.2.
Watsa also left his position in Motorola Mobility Holdings, which
he owned 15,000 shares of, at an average price of $39. He bought
the position in the third quarter of 2011 at an average price of
$31. Motorola Mobility Holdings operates as a provider of
technologies products and services for handset and television
set-top box units.
Google acquired Motorola in May for $12.5 billion.
